- (1) remove any visible dirt on the bottom of the geothermal pool at least once every 24 hours or more frequently as needed to keep the pool free of dirt and debris;
- (2) clean the water surface of the geothermal pool as often as needed to keep the pool free of scum or floating matter;
- (3) keep geothermal pool surfaces, decks, handrails, floors, walls, and ceilings of rooms enclosing pools, dressing rooms and equipment rooms clean, sanitary, and in good repair; and
- (4) keep handholds, handrails, entrance points, walkways, dressing rooms, and equipment rooms clean and in good repair.
